WebMar 23, 2013 · Sat Mar 23, 2013 by Dave Phillips. Early Extension is the most common swing characteristics in golf. It is simply defined as any forward movement of the pelvis toward the ball on the backswing or downswing. WebEarly Extension is defined as any forward movement (thrust) of the lower body towards the golf ball during the downswing.
